Overview

An established infrastructure operator is seeking an experienced Electrical Engineer III to lead complex electrical engineering initiatives supporting critical operational facilities.

This role blends technical depth in power systems with project leadership responsibilities. You will design, optimise, and support electrical distribution systems across industrial facilities while ensuring alignment with operational, safety, and regulatory stand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and optimise electrical systems and power distribution networks supporting infrastructure such as pipelines, compressor stations, and storage facilities

  • Develop one-line diagrams, electrical schematics, system layouts, and perform load calculations

  • Integrate advanced technologies including automation, real-time monitoring, and energy storage solutions

  • Implement robust safety measures including arc flash mitigation and fault detection systems

  • Provide technical expertise for new construction projects and upgrades to existing facilities

  • Participate in complex engineering projects from concept through completion, ensuring alignment with scope, timeline, and budget

  • Ensure compliance with safety, environmental, and regulatory standards

  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to deliver engineering solutions

  • Support procurement processes for electrical equipment and materials

  • Participate in commissioning, testing, and startup of electrical systems
